Transaction 75286f93a7ac03faa877d44c29ace521d3c0965accd16f4923df8d6f15f6795a

1 Input
2 Outputs
  • 75286f93a7ac03faa877d44c29ace521d3c0965accd16f4923df8d6f15f6795a:0
  • value  34963
    address  3KvMCGFzN9Y7mDbm8jU1XDaLEeGUHLgPpo
  • 75286f93a7ac03faa877d44c29ace521d3c0965accd16f4923df8d6f15f6795a:1
  • value  296843
    address  1JTC6cWX1QevVr5Tsae9PqetWpSwCThrCn